Palghar, Maharashtra: Following the recent terrorist attack on tourists in Pahalgam, Jammu and Kashmir, a protest was held by the Muslim community of Palghar city on Friday. After offering prayers at the city's Jama Masjid, a large number of community members gathered outside to express their strong condemnation of the incident.
The brutal attack in Pahalgam has sparked outrage across the country, with protests and demonstrations being organized at various locations. Reflecting the nationwide sentiment, the Muslim community of Palghar also organized a protest to denounce the attack.
During the demonstration, members of the community tied black bands on their arms as a mark of mourning and paid tribute to the tourists who lost their lives in the attack. Protesters chanted slogans such as "Pakistan Murdabad" (Death to Pakistan) and demanded strong action against Pakistan and severe punishment for the perpetrators. The demonstrators also burned the national flag of Pakistan as a symbol of their anger and frustration.
The protestors demanded strong and decisive action against terrorism and called for the permanent eradication of terrorist forces from the region.
